B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, precisely formulated for feed-quality use and examined to satisfy stringent excellent and safety standards. BHT is a lipophilic organic compound that may be principally used as an antioxidant in different industrial purposes. In animal nourishment, BHT FEED GRADE TEST is extensively utilized to forestall the oxidation of fats and oils in animal feed, thereby preserving the nutritional value and lengthening the shelf lifetime of the feed. Oxidized fats don't just get rid of nutritional efficacy but can also generate hazardous compounds, impacting the wellness and development of livestock. The inclusion of BHT in feed needs arduous tests to be sure it adheres to regulatory requirements and is also Risk-free for usage by animals, which at some point enters the human foods chain. The tests protocols generally evaluate the purity, efficacy, and prospective residues in animal tissues.
Yet another vital compound while in the chemical area is Pentachloropyridine. This compound is a chlorinated by-product of pyridine and has garnered fascination resulting from its utility as an intermediate inside the synthesis of agrochemicals, dyes, and pharmaceuticals. Its higher degree of chlorination can make it a powerful compound, which should be managed with care because of likely toxicity and environmental problems. Pentachloropyridine serves like a making block in chemical synthesis, enabling chemists to create far more sophisticated molecules Which may be Employed in herbicides, insecticides, and even specialty polymers. The dealing with and disposal of Pentachloropyridine are regulated, presented its potential environmental persistence and bioaccumulation hazard. Industries working with this compound frequently adopt shut-system generation approaches and arduous basic safety protocols to reduce exposure.
M-Phenylene Diamine, frequently abbreviated as MPD, is really an aromatic amine that capabilities prominently during the creation of aramid fibers, that are perfectly-noted for their heat resistance and energy. Kevlar and Nomex, Utilized in system armor and fireplace-resistant clothing, respectively, are developed working with MPD to be a essential precursor. The compound by itself contains a benzene ring with two amino teams inside the meta positions, rendering it appropriate for generating polymers with desirable thermal and mechanical Homes. M-Phenylene Diamine (MPD) is additionally Utilized in the dye business, particularly in hair dyes as well as other cosmetic programs, Despite the fact that its use has actually been curtailed in certain regions due to safety considerations. When manufacturing products made up of MPD, appropriate occupational basic safety techniques are necessary to protect staff from extended exposure, which could lead to skin sensitization or other health concerns.
O-Phenylene Diamine (OPDA), when structurally similar to MPD, differs from the positioning from the amino groups, which significantly influences its chemical reactivity and software. OPDA is often used inside the production of dyes and pigments, where it contributes on the development of vivid shades that are stable and long-Long lasting. It is also Utilized in the synthesis of heterocyclic compounds and prescribed drugs. OPDA’s role in corrosion inhibitors and rubber chemical substances more highlights its flexibility. Even so, comparable to other aromatic amines, OPDA is likewise affiliated with toxicity pitfalls, and thus, its use is thoroughly managed and monitored. The significance of correct dealing with, appropriate storage, and sufficient protective measures can not be overstated when dealing with OPDA in almost any industrial location.
Pinacolone is yet another noteworthy compound with various apps. It's a ketone Along with the molecular formula C6H12O and is also applied generally being an intermediate from the synthesis of pesticides and herbicides, specially from the manufacture of triazole fungicides and particular plant expansion regulators. Pinacolone’s construction features a tertiary butyl group, which contributes to its special reactivity in natural and organic synthesis. Over and above agriculture, it may also be found in the manufacture of prescribed drugs and fragrances. Pinacolone is valued for its BHT FEED GRADE-TEST capacity to undertake nucleophilic substitution and condensation reactions, making it a useful reagent in laboratory and industrial procedures. Whilst it's significantly less hazardous than a few of the previously reviewed compounds, security safety measures are still essential to mitigate any hazards connected with its volatility and prospective irritant Homes.
two-Heptanone is really a ketone that By natural means happens in some crops and can be located in compact portions in human sweat and sure animal secretions. It is often used in the fragrance and flavor industries because of its enjoyable, fruity odor. Also, two-Heptanone has discovered apps for a solvent and intermediate in natural and organic synthesis. Curiously, analysis has advised that it may Enjoy a job in chemical signaling, significantly in insects, wherever it acts as an alarm pheromone. This has brought about its analyze in pest Regulate methods and behavioral science. Industrially, 2-Heptanone is synthesized for use in coatings, adhesives, and cleaners. Its rather minimal toxicity can make it suitable for use in customer merchandise, Even though proper labeling and managing Directions are constantly mandated.
